Application.AdvancedSearchStopped-Ereignis (Outlook)
Tritt auf, wenn ein angegebenen Search -Objekt Beenden -Methode ausgeführt wurde.
Syntax
Ausdruck.
AdvancedSearchStopped
( _SearchObject_
)
expression Eine Variable, die ein Application-Objekt darstellt.
Parameter
Name | Erforderlich/Optional | Datentyp | Beschreibung |
---|---|---|---|
SearchObject | Erforderlich | Search | Die Search -Objekt, das von der AdvancedSearch -Methode zurückgegeben. |
Hinweise
Nachdem dieses Ereignis ausgelöst wurde, wird die Results-Auflistung des Search-Objekts nicht mehr aktualisiert. Dieses Ereignis kann nur programmgesteuert ausgelöst werden.
Beispiel
Im folgenden Beispiel für Visual Basic für Applikationen (VBA) wird die Suche im Posteingang nach Objekten mit dem Betreff "Test" gestartet und sofort beendet. Dadurch wird die AdvanceSearchStopped
Ereignisprozedur ausgeführt. Der Beispielcode muss in einem Klassenmodul wie ThisOutlookSession
platziert werden. Die StopSearch()
Prozedur muss aufgerufen werden, bevor die Ereignisprozedur von Microsoft Outlook aufgerufen werden kann.
Sub StopSearch()
Dim sch As Outlook.Search
Dim strScope As String
Dim strFilter As String
strScope = "Inbox"
strFilter = "urn:schemas:httpmail:subject = 'Test'"
Set sch = Application.AdvancedSearch(strScope, strFilter)
sch.Stop
End Sub
Private Sub Application_AdvancedSearchStopped(ByVal SearchObject As Search)
'Inform the user that the search has stopped.
MsgBox "An AdvancedSearch has been interrupted and stopped. "
End Sub
Siehe auch
Support und Feedback
Haben Sie Fragen oder Feedback zu Office VBA oder zu dieser Dokumentation? Unter Office VBA-Support und Feedback finden Sie Hilfestellung zu den Möglichkeiten, wie Sie Support erhalten und Feedback abgeben können.